SC vacates stay on Adani SEZ in Gujarat news
09 July 2008

Mumbai: The Supreme Court has vacated a stay on the work at Adani Group's Rs7,400-crore multi-product special economic zone in Gujarat, allowing the group to restart work.

A bench headed by Chief Justice K G Balakrishnan, while dismissing the petition by a group of fishermen as withdrawn, asked the Adani Group not to fill the creeks.

Acting on a petition by fishermen that the project would affect their livelihood and flora and fauna in the region, the Supreme Court had, last week, directed the Adani Group to maintain status quo with regard to all activities taking place on the land.

The apex court had also issued notices to the union ministries of commerce, environment and forests, the Gujarat government, Mundra Ports and SEZ and the Adani Group.

Appearing for Adani Group, counsels Harish Salve and Ankur Chawla argued that the allegations against the SEZ were baseless and aimed at pressuring the group for illegal gains. The company had not indulged in land grabbing but had acquired the land strictly in accordance with law after giving a public hearing and paying compensation and premium for rehabilitation, they argued.

Since the petition stands dismissed and withdrawn at the SC, a petition pending with the Gujarat high court is also expected to be dismissed.

Mundra SEZ, established under the SEZ Act of 2005, is proposed to be set up over a 6,000-acre area with an investment of Rs7,400 crore.

The Mundra Port is a running port since 1998 and all related activities were being undertaken in accordance with the law and after obtaining necessary clearances, the company said in its petition.

The group had already invested over Rs3,500 crore in port development and planned to invest another Rs4,000 crore, the application said.

The Adani Group, with an annual turnover of $ 4.3 bilion, is a dynamic and well-diversified group having interests in oil and ports.

With interests in high-growth businesses like ports, power, infrastructure, international trade, logistics, energy, agriculture, fuel etc, the Adani Group is the operator of largest private port in India and the developer of the largest multi-product SEZ in India.

The group also have the largest edible oil refining capacity in India and is one of the largest trading houses in the country.
